Job Description

We are seeking a Customer Support Specialist to be the primary point of contact for our customers. This role requires an individual who excels at multitasking, remains calm under pressure, and has a customer-first mentality. You will answer calls, chats, and emails, provide exceptional customer service, onboard new customers, and support ongoing customer success initiatives. While prior experience with CRM tools like Hubspot is a plus, we are willing to train the right candidate. The role demands excellent communication skills, technical aptitude, and the ability to manage multiple communication channels simultaneously.
